cm602用什么编程

不及物动词 其他 66

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    CM602是指ABB机器人中的一种型号,它采用了ABB自家开发的编程语言——RAPID编程语言。

    RAPID是Robot Application Programming Interface for Development的缩写,意为机器人应用程序开发接口。它是一种类似于高级编程语言的机器人控制语言,主要用于控制ABB机器人执行复杂的任务和动作。通过RAPID编程,用户可以灵活地定义机器人的运动方式、逻辑执行顺序以及与外部设备的交互等。

    RAPID语言具有以下特点:

    1. 结构化:RAPID语言采用结构化的编程风格,支持常见的编程结构,如条件判断、循环、函数等,便于用户实现复杂的控制逻辑。
    2. 直观:RAPID语言具有良好的可读性,类似于一种简化的编程语言,对于有编程经验的用户来说,上手相对较快。
    3. 可扩展:RAPID语言支持用户自定义函数、模块和库,可以根据特定的应用需求进行扩展和定制。
    4. 与机器人硬件紧密集成:RAPID语言与ABB机器人硬件紧密结合,可以直接访问机器人的传感器、执行器等,方便进行机器人控制和数据处理。

    总结来说,CM602机器人使用RAPID编程语言,通过编写RAPID代码,用户可以灵活控制机器人的动作和逻辑,实现各种复杂的自动化任务。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    CM602是一种机器人控制器,它通常与机械臂和其他机器人设备一起使用。CM602控制器使用ROBOPLUS软件套件进行编程。ROBOPLUS是一个通用的机器人编程平台,它提供了基于图形化编程和文本编程的两种方式来编写控制机器人的程序。

    1. 图形化编程:ROBOPLUS的图形化编程界面非常直观和易于使用,特别适合初学者。在图形化界面中,用户可以通过拖动和放置不同的程序块来创建程序。这些程序块可以代表机器人的运动、传感器输入、条件判断、循环等等。用户只需按照自己的需求设置程序块的属性,即可编写出功能完整的控制程序。

    2. 文本编程:ROBOPLUS还提供了文本编程的选项,用户可以使用ROBOPLUS提供的编程语言(如C++)来编写自己的机器人程序。这种编程方式更加灵活和强大,适合有一定编程经验的用户。通过文本编程,用户可以更深入地控制机器人的各个方面,并实现更复杂的功能。

    3. 可视化调试:ROBOPLUS提供了一个可视化调试界面,用户可以在该界面中实时监测机器人的传感器状态和运动情况。这对于程序调试和错误排查非常有帮助,用户可以通过观察机器人的行为来判断程序是否正常运行。

    4. 数据管理:ROBOPLUS还提供了数据管理功能,用户可以在其中设置和保存机器人的关节角度、传感器数据等状态信息。这样,在编程过程中,用户可以随时调用和修改这些数据,实现更加灵活的控制策略。

    5. 扩展性:CM602控制器还支持与其他传感器和外围设备的连接,通过ROBOPLUS编程,用户可以方便地将这些设备整合到机器人控制系统中,实现更广泛的应用。例如,用户可以通过编程实现机器人的自主导航、物体识别和抓取等高级功能。

    总之,CM602控制器使用ROBOPLUS软件套件进行编程,提供了图形化编程和文本编程两种方式,以及可视化调试和数据管理功能。这些特点让用户能够灵活地控制机器人,并实现各种复杂的任务。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    CM602是一种机器人控制器,主要用于机器人的运动控制和程序控制。它使用的是特定的编程语言来编写机器人的程序,通常使用的编程语言有以下几种。

    1. RAPID语言:RAPID是ABB机器人控制器上的编程语言,它具有结构化编程和模块化编程的特点,可用于编写各种各样的机器人应用程序。RAPID语言的语法类似于C语言,具有函数、变量、条件语句、循环结构等基本编程元素。

    2. Karel语言:Karel是一种简单易学的教学式编程语言,主要用于初学者学习机器人编程。它使用简单的命令和指令来控制机器人的运动和操作,适合于小规模的机器人项目。

    3. Python语言:Python是一种通用的高级编程语言,也可以用于编写机器人控制程序。通过Python的库和模块,可以编写复杂的机器人应用程序,例如图像处理、路径规划等领域。在CM602控制器上,可以通过安装相应的软件包来支持Python编程。

    4. C/C++语言:C/C++是一种广泛使用的编程语言,也可以用于机器人控制器的编程。通过使用相应的API和库函数,可以实现高度定制化的机器人控制程序。

    不同编程语言适用于不同的应用场景,选择适合自己需求的编程语言,可以更好地编写和控制机器人程序。在选定编程语言后,可以使用相应的开发环境和工具,通过编写程序代码来实现对CM602控制器的编程控制。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部